The SDR role is changing because of AI. What used to take hours, now takes minutes. But does that mean they are any less valuable? I don’t believe so. But I believe GTM teams need to adapt to this shift. The Old Way: A) An SDR is given a list of accounts. B) They reach out across email, LinkedIn and the phone. The New Way: A) Specialists own a channel. B) Systems sync prospecting across channels. What does that mean for the SDR? In my opinion, one of 2 things: 1/ You double down on ā€˜human skills’. AI isn’t coming for people who are great at cold calling anytime soon. But also, it means more time spent on: - Working complex deals - Account planning strategy - Building relationships & multithreading 2/ You lean into the technical side of outbound Learn how to use AI and technologies such as Relevance AI, Clay, Instantly.ai, lemlist, Common Room & others to build GTM Systems. The best SDR teams have both: → GTM Engineers build systems, create large scale prospecting campaigns and feed laser-accurate data to SDRs. → SDRs book meetings through manual outreach and phone prospecting. That’s what we do for ourselves. That’s what our clients who get the best results do. That’s what Dan currently implements for $1B+ organizations. Are you seeing the same shift?

I spent 300 hours researching 1,500+ software. Here's how to upgrade your tech stack with AI: 1ļøāƒ£ Use AI apps for building leads lists Your ability to put the message in front of the right person is the biggest predictor of your outreach campaign's success. Some AI applications make the process easier by helping you: - Build lead lists - Deeply research prospects - Segment & score prospect Examples include: - Relevance AI Prospect Researcher and Enrichment agents - Clay’s AI Agent and Integration with 100+ data platforms. - Exa’s AI Research & Data Sourcing Agent 2ļøāƒ£ Use AI to orchestrate complex workflows Running cold email campaigns used to be fragmented across several platforms and involved moving around .csv files from one tool to another. Workflow builders & AI agents now help you: - Build a list  - Score your leads - Find their Emails - Verify these Emails - Personalise your messaging with AI - And import to leads to a sales engagement platform … all that from a single tool. Examples for these tools include Clay, Relevance AI, Common Room & Unify. 3ļøāƒ£ Use AI to improve your deliverability A message that doesn’t get read, doesn’t get replied to. Every year, deliverability is getting harder to crack. Thankfully, a few sending platforms are leveraging AI to help with: - Secondary domains & mailboxes setup - Automated Spintaxxing - Email warm-ups Examples include: Instantly.ai, lemlist & Woodpecker.co. 4ļøāƒ£ Use AI to help close your deals We’re still far from seeing AI successfully replacing humans in Google Meet. But the AI bots are already listening to these sales conversations. They already help by: - Taking notes from convos - Surfacing insights from individual conversations - Surfacing aggregate insights from MANY conversations For example, one thing I like to do is ask Attention what our prospects have asked most in our latest 100+ sales conversations. Once I know that, I can address these points in our messaging. P.S: Any unheard-of use case you’ve seen with AI applied to go-to-market?
